    Many small towns have un-used space in their downtown. A local resident in Buffalo, Oklahoma, has used some of that space to create short-term lodging for hunters. Julia Hinther runs a salon and gift shop. The space upstairs used to be an apartment for her sons. When one of her sons tried his luck with…

    Erratic or limited hours are a frequent complaint about small town businesses. But how can you convince small business owners to expand their hours? My friend Charles French sent me this very neat tool: “while you were out” notes for businesses. Here’s how it works. Customers use them to let businesses know when and how…
